December 13 1918
The first flight from England to India begins when a Handley-Page V/1500 bomber takes off from Martlesham Heath, piloted by Major A.S.C. MacLaren and Captain Robert Halley, navigated by Sergeant Thomas Brown with Flight Sergeants Crockett and Smith as fitters. Brigadier General Norman MacEwen rides along as a passenger. The previous July MacLaren had piloted the first flight from England to Egypt in a Handley-Page 0/400.
